Posted On 2026년 04월 22일

윈도우 세상에도 찾아온 네트워크의 미니멀리즘

nobaksan 0 comments
여행하는 개발자 >> 기술 >> 윈도우 세상에도 찾아온 네트워크의 미니멀리즘

WireGuard가 윈도우 1.0 버전에 도달했다는 소식은, 단순히 또 하나의 소프트웨어 업데이트가 아니다. 이는 복잡한 네트워크 보안의 세계에서 미니멀리즘이 승리한 순간이다. 20년 전만 해도 VPN은 기업용 솔루션의 상징처럼 여겨졌다. IPSec의 방대한 설정 파일, OpenVPN의 느린 핸드셰이크, 그리고 그 모든 복잡성을 감당해야 하는 관리자의 고충. 그런 시절에 WireGuard는 “왜 이렇게 복잡해야 하는가”라는 근본적인 질문을 던졌다.

WireGuard의 설계 철학은 단순함 그 자체다. UDP 기반의 가벼운 프로토콜, 최소한의 코드 라인, 그리고 직관적인 설정 방식. 이 모든 것이 “적은 것이 더 많다”는 유닉스 철학을 네트워크 보안에 적용한 결과물이다. 윈도우 1.0 버전의 출시가 의미하는 것은, 이 철학이 이제 마이크로소프트의 플랫폼에서도 완전히 자리 잡았다는 증거다. 과거 윈도우에서 VPN을 구축하려면 드라이버 서명 문제, 호환성 이슈, 그리고 끝없는 설정 파일과의 싸움이 필수였다. 하지만 WireGuard는 이런 장애물을 하나씩 제거하며, 개발자와 사용자 모두에게 “그냥 작동한다”는 경험을 제공한다.

특히 주목할 점은 WireGuardNT의 도입이다. 윈도우 커널 모드에서 동작하는 이 구현체는 성능과 안정성 모두에서 기존 사용자 모드 구현을 뛰어넘는다. 패킷 손실 없는 IP 주소 변경, 낮은 MTU 지원 등 세부적인 개선 사항들은, 이 프로젝트가 단순한 취미 프로젝트가 아니라 실제 운영 환경에서 검증된 기술임을 보여준다. 이는 오픈소스 프로젝트로서 드문 사례다. 보통 기술은 실무에서 검증된 후 오픈소스로 공개되는 경우가 많지만, WireGuard는 그 반대였다. 먼저 아이디어와 코드가 공개되었고, 이후 기업과 개인 모두가 이를 신뢰하기 시작했다.

하지만 모든 기술이 그렇듯, WireGuard에도 고민할 지점이 있다. 단순함이라는 장점이 때로는 유연성의 부족으로 이어질 수 있다. 예를 들어, 다중 프로토콜 지원이나 복잡한 라우팅 시나리오에서는 여전히 IPSec이나 OpenVPN이 더 나은 선택일 수 있다. 또한, 윈도우 1.0 버전의 출시가 “완벽한” 솔루션을 의미하지는 않는다. 보안 소프트웨어는 끊임없이 진화해야 하며, 새로운 취약점이 발견될 때마다 대응해야 한다. WireGuard의 단순함이 오히려 보안 검토를 용이하게 만들지만, 그것이 절대적인 안전함을 보장하지는 않는다.

이 기술이 주는 가장 큰 교훈은 아마도 “더 간단하게”라는 원칙의 힘일 것이다. 소프트웨어 개발에서 복잡성은 종종 필연적인 것처럼 여겨진다. 새로운 기능을 추가할수록 코드는 비대해지고, 버그는 늘어나며, 유지보수는 어려워진다. 하지만 WireGuard는 이런 흐름에 저항한다. “필요한 것만 남기고 나머지는 버린다”는 접근 방식은, 네트워크 보안이라는 복잡한 분야에서조차 통할 수 있음을 증명했다. 이는 다른 분야의 개발자들에게도 시사하는 바가 크다. 때로는 문제를 더 작게 쪼개고, 더 단순하게 생각하는 것이 혁신의 시작일 수 있다.

윈도우 1.0 버전의 출시가 WireGuard의 여정을 끝내는 것은 아니다. 오히려 이제부터가 진정한 시작일지도 모른다. 기업 환경에서의 채택 확대, 클라우드 네이티브 환경과의 통합, 그리고 더 많은 플랫폼으로의 확장. 이 기술이 앞으로 어떤 방향으로 진화할지 지켜보는 것은 흥미로운 일이 될 것이다. 한 가지 확실한 것은, WireGuard가 네트워크 보안의 패러다임을 바꾼다는 점이다. 복잡함이 미덕이었던 시대는 이제 막을 내리고 있다.

관련 정보: WireGuard for Windows Reaches v1.0


이 포스팅은 쿠팡 파트너스 활동의 일환으로, 이에 따른 일정액의 수수료를 제공받습니다.

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다

Related Post

디지털 쓰레기장의 부활: Digg가 보여주는 인터넷의 피로감

몇 년 전, 한 친구가 내게 "인터넷이 점점 쓰레기장이 되어가는 것 같아"라고 말했다. 당시에는 그저…

유행 너머의 개발법: 보이지 않는 지혜를 찾아서

소프트웨어 개발이라는 여정에서 우리는 과연 얼마나 새로운 길을 찾아왔을까요? 아니면 그저 오래된 지혜를 새로운 이름으로…

역량이 설계하는 미래의 길

소프트웨어 개발 현장은 언제나 변동과 예측 불가능성으로 가득 차 있다. 새로운 프레임워크가 등장하고, 클라우드 서비스가…